No island was destroyed by a volcano in 1998. However, in 1995 a large portion of the island of Montserrat was left uninhabitable by volcanic eruptions. The people were able to move to the UK in 1998.
The eruption in Montserrat was managed through a combination of evacuation of residents from the affected areas, monitoring volcanic activity, establishing exclusion zones, and public education on volcanic risks. The Montserrat Volcano Observatory played a crucial role in monitoring and providing early warnings to help minimize the impact of the eruption. International assistance and support also played a significant role in helping manage the crisis.
